If You Are in Crisis
If you are currently in crisis or feel unsafe, please seek immediate help. Go to your nearest emergency room or contact local emergency services right away. Your safety is the priority.
The Super‑Human Resilience Project is a supportive community, but it is not a crisis response service. If you need urgent care, please reach out to professionals who can provide immediate assistance.
Resources for Veterans and First Responders
If you are a veteran, active‑duty service member, or first responder experiencing a mental health crisis, there are dedicated resources available to support you:
Veterans Crisis Support Services Confidential support for veterans, service members, and their families.
First Responder Crisis Support Lines Peer‑based and professional support for firefighters, EMS personnel, and law enforcement.
National Crisis Hotlines and Text Services Available 24/7 for anyone experiencing emotional distress or thoughts of self‑harm.
These services exist because your life and well‑being matter. Reaching out is a sign of strength, not weakness.
